Transaction 6d76a657ef6f73691503db593519e66dfd824df30bf143183e1e5227464b773e
1 Input
1 Output
-
6d76a657ef6f73691503db593519e66dfd824df30bf143183e1e5227464b773e:0
- value
- 73387
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c85487f3169dfffdecef7d5a123605c973702a1
- address
- bc1q8jz5sle3d80llhkw7l26zgmqtjtnwq4pwxe6gy